Extracts an ULONG value from a PROPVARIANT structure. If no value can be extracted, then a default value is assigned.
Syntax
PSSTDAPI PropVariantToUInt32(
[in] REFPROPVARIANT propvarIn,
[out] ULONG *pulRet
);
Parameters
[in] propvarIn
Type: REFPROPVARIANT
A reference to a source PROPVARIANT structure.
[out] pulRet
Type: ULONG*
When this function returns, contains the extracted property value if one exists; otherwise, 0.
Return value
Type: HRESULT
If this function succeeds, it returns S_OK. Otherwise, it returns an HRESULT error code.
Remarks
This helper function is used in places where the calling application expects a PROPVARIANT to hold a ULONG value. For instance, an application obtaining values from a property store can use this to safely extract the ULONG value for UInt32 properties.
If the source PROPVARIANT has type VT_UI4, this helper function extracts the ULONG value. Otherwise, it attempts to convert the value in the PROPVARIANT structure into a ULONG. If a conversion is not possible, PropVariantToUInt32 will return a failure code and set pulRet to 0. See PropVariantChangeType for a list of possible conversions. Of note, VT_EMPTY is successfully converted to 0.
Examples
The following example, to be included as part of a larger program, demonstrates how to use PropVariantToUInt32 to access a ULONG value in a PROPVARIANT.
// IPropertyStore *ppropstore;
// Assume variable ppropstore is initialized and valid
PROPVARIANT propvar = {0};
HRESULT hr = ppropstore->GetValue(PKEY_Rating, &propvar);
if (SUCCEEDED(hr))
{
// PKEY_Rating is expected to produce a VT_UI4 or VT_EMPTY value.
// PropVariantToUInt32 will convert VT_EMPTY to 0.
ULONG uRating;
hr = PropVariantToUInt32(propvar, &uRating);
if (SUCCEEDED(hr))
{
// uRating is now valid
}
else
{
// uRating is always 0
}
PropVariantClear(&propvar);
}
Requirements
| Requirement | Value |
|---|---|
| Minimum supported client | Windows XP with SP2, Windows Vista [desktop apps only] |
| Minimum supported server | Windows Server 2003 with SP1 [desktop apps only] |
| Target Platform | Windows |
| Header | propvarutil.h |
| Library | Propsys.lib |
| DLL | Propsys.dll (version 6.0 or later) |
| Redistributable | Windows Desktop Search (WDS) 3.0 |
